Reichert was picked up in the wee hours of this morning (Wednesday, August 3), and in evidence is 5,000 GRAMS of weed. If you do the math, that's well over 11 pounds. The Southern Illinois Enforcement Group (SIEG) is supposed to have been taking the credit for the bust, and it's being reported that there may be other tendrils reaching out from this one, including a connection to Arizona, where it's hard to grow pot (but not hard to concoct other product to trade for it).
Wherever it goes, the confirmed official wording on the arresting charge is Possession of Cannabis more than 5,000 grams...which in the user vernacular is known as delivery amounts, not user amounts for sure.
We've also had it confirmed that neither Tina Reichert nor her buddy, Lonnie Brymer, were taken to the Williamson County Sheriff's Department nor, as we pointed out yesterday, were they arrested. They were, however, secured and transported to another location for questioning, then released.
